Cracking or Peeling Off Surfaces



When the paint on your home's outside starts to exhibit fracturing or peeling off surfaces, it indicates a need for interest and upkeep to support the residential or commercial property's visual allure. Cracking happens when https://interiorpaintersnearme74062.techionblog.com/33913822/check-out-the-essential-concerns-to-posture-prior-to-involving-home-painters-and-unveil-the-strategies-for-freshening-your-home-with-a-new-coat-of-paint splits open, frequently resembling a dried-up riverbed, while peeling off happens when the paint sheds its attachment to the surface beneath it.

These issues not only interfere with the looks of your home however also compromise the protection the paint provides against the elements.

Fracturing and peeling surface areas can be caused by numerous variables such as poor surface prep work before painting, use low-quality paint, exposure to extreme climate condition, or merely the all-natural aging of the paint. Overlooking these indicators can lead to more damage to the hidden surface areas, potentially resulting in extra comprehensive and pricey repair work in the future.

To attend to cracking or peeling off surfaces, it is crucial to scrape off the loose paint, sand the area, use a primer, and repaint the damaged areas. By taking painter marketing to fix these problems, you can maintain your home's outside charm and secure it from prospective wear and tear.

Wood Rot or Water Damage



Discovery of wood rot or water damage on your home's surface areas requires prompt focus to stop additional architectural damage and maintain the integrity of the property. Timber rot, a result of prolonged exposure to wetness, can compromise the structure of your home, endangering its stability. Common signs of timber rot include soft or squishy areas, discoloration, or a musty smell.

Water damage, often triggered by leaks or bad drainage, can lead to peeling off paint, inflamed wood, or water discolorations on walls. If left uncontrolled, water damages can intensify, causing extra substantial and expensive fixings.

To deal with timber rot or water damage, start by determining and repairing the resource of the concern to stop future damages. Replace any kind of deteriorated timber, seal any type of leaks, and guarantee correct ventilation in areas prone to moisture build-up. After resolving the root cause, consider repainting the impacted locations to shield them from additional wear and tear.

Regular upkeep and prompt repair work are essential to preserving the beauty and structural stability of your home.
